About This Meme Template

The 'Zombieland money tears' meme template features the character Tallahassee, played by Woody Harrelson, from the 2009 post-apocalyptic comedy film Zombieland. In this iconic loop, Tallahassee is seen lying down, visibly distraught and weeping, but instead of reaching for a tissue, he uses a thick fan of hundred-dollar bills to wipe the tears from his eyes. The motion is deliberate and rhythmic, emphasizing the absurdity of being wealthy enough to use currency as a disposable cleaning product while still experiencing profound emotional distress. The lighting is warm and cinematic, contrasting with the dark humor of the situation. This template perfectly captures the concept of 'suffering from success' or the irony of 'first world problems' where one's financial abundance makes their complaints seem trivial or performative to others.

Originally occurring during a scene where Tallahassee reflects on the loss of his son (initially believed to be a dog), the clip has transcended its movie origins to become a universal digital shorthand for mocking wealthy individuals or entities who feign hardship. Culturally, it serves as a sarcastic rebuttal to the phrase 'money can't buy happiness,' suggesting that while money may not solve all problems, it certainly provides a more comfortable way to be miserable. It is frequently utilized in discussions regarding the stock market, cryptocurrency volatility, high-paying but soul-crushing corporate jobs, and the out-of-touch nature of celebrities or CEOs during economic crises.
